Safety

Whether you are looking to purchase treadmills at in your home or have one already it is safe to be one of the most important aspects in your decision. Follow these simple tips to prevent injuries. The first is to ensure that your treadmill is in a safe area where it will not be accessible to children or others who aren't educated in treadmill safety. This means keeping it in a space or space that is locked or secured when not in use and making sure to unplug the power cord at the end of each session. This will stop it from being turned on accidentally and possibly moving or running with a pet or person standing near it.

It is important to understand the design and how your treadmill functions. This will let you be aware of what to do in the event that the machine has to stop working for instance, if someone comes into it, or it gets caught in a piece of clothing. Be aware of the emergency shutoff button and tether on most treadmills. These will stop the belt if your balance becomes unstable while running, and prevent serious injury.

Listen for the warning beeps or 3-2-1 countdowns the machine makes when it is ready to move. Many people fail to remember this, especially if they are distracted by the TV or other exercise equipment in the room. This can lead people to not notice the warning, and step off the machine too early. They could fall and possibly hurt themselves.

It is crucial to only use a treadmill if it is being monitored by an adult. Children are particularly susceptible to injuries resulting from treadmills and should be kept clear of them. It is also best to avoid standing or leaning on the handrails when you exercise. You can use them for assistance while walking but not to stand while you run. If you'd like to be extra vigilant you can buy a device that clips to your clothes and stops the treadmill when it detects that you've fallen off. When an employee is hurt on the job, they need to report it as soon as they can. This will help prevent delays and problems when it comes to receiving workers compensation benefits.

Workers compensation benefits typically comprise medical treatment as well as vocational rehabilitation services and disability benefits. These benefits may differ in the amount and duration of benefits from one state to the next.

Medical Treatment

Workers' compensation claims cover medical treatment for injuries that are sustained while working. This type of insurance will cover medical visits, hospital stays imaging studies (x-rays) as well as blood tests, and the cost of rehabilitation therapies.

To encourage objective healing and to meet goals of returning to work, the New York State Workers' Comp Board establishes medical treatment guidelines (MTGs). These guidelines are regularly updated in accordance with medical advances and doctor's recommendations.

These guidelines are intended to ensure that injured workers receive the same treatment as other employees who suffer from work-related injuries and illnesses. These guidelines ensure that the proper treatment is provided for any illness or injury and that there aren't unnecessary medical costs.

If a physician determines that medical treatment isn't necessary under the MTGs, he/she can request an exception from the insurer, asking for a specific exception to these MTGs. This procedure is very complex and can take months to complete.

If the treatment is needed, the employer or the insurer should make every effort to provide the treatment. If there is disagreement between the employer and the employee, it is possible to fail to provide the treatment. This can often be resolved by an evidentiary court before an administrator law judge.

The treatment should be administered by licensed local health professional who is licensed to offer workers' compensation treatment. In emergencies, an unlicensed or uncertified doctor might be able to treat worker's injuries in the event that they were notified about the accident and have completed the appropriate first injury report.

Many doctors are certified in workers' compensation and can offer lower prices for treating injured employees. This is especially helpful to patients who have suffered an injury that is serious.

Many medical professionals can provide assistance to injured employees in addition to doctors. These include chiropractors, occupational therapists, and physical therapists.

Compensation is payable to railroad workers or their families if they get injured at work or suffer fatal injuries as a result. It is harder to prove liability than standard workers' compensation claims.

In order to receive a fair and equitable compensation, railroad employees must prove that their injuries or deaths were due to the negligence of the railroad company. This is why having a proper record is crucial.

Recovering damages

Signals and switches for trains are vital safety devices that can prevent catastrophic and deadly collisions between trains. If these systems aren't maintained or repaired correctly railroad workers could be seriously injured by their failure. A successful claim under the Federal Employers Liability Act (FELA) could result in compensation for medical expenses and lost wages. It isn't easy to collect damages without the assistance of an experienced attorney.

A skilled FELA lawyer has years of experience in defending clients and defending their rights. They will conduct an extensive investigation to determine if the railroad's negligence was responsible for the accident that caused your injury. Additionally, they will assure that the railroad company pays you full and fair compensation for the losses you suffered.

The burden of evidence in a FELA case is lower than it is in a workers compensation case. This allows railroad workers who have been injured to receive a better compensation. Your lawyer will be able to leverage this advantage during negotiations with the insurance company. They can also help you collect the necessary documentation to support your claim, like medical documents and bills.

In contrast to workers' compensation, FELA requires that the railroad demonstrate its negligence in the incident that led to your injuries. This is done by proving they failed to provide you with a safe workplace and that their negligence directly caused your injury. This can be a challenging task however, your FELA lawyer will work tirelessly to demonstrate that the railroad company is responsible for your losses and injuries.

If you've been injured while working, you should contact an FELA lawyer with experience immediately. They may make a federal claim against the railroad company if they were negligent in creating the injury. The FELA statute is three years long, so it's crucial to contact a qualified lawyer as soon as you can in order to protect your rights.

FELA provides compensation to family members in the event of a fatal train accident. The money is used to compensate for the financial strain that a loved one's death has caused. The money could be used to pay funeral expenses, future earnings, as well as the loss of consortium or companionship.

A Step-By Step Guide To Personal Injury Legal What is personal injury lawyers Injury Litigation?

Personal injury litigation is a legal proceeding in which a person is injured because of the negligence of another party. It allows individuals to seek monetary compensation for mental, physical and reputational damage caused by others' actions or inactions.

The amount of damages you could expect to receive is contingent upon the severity of your injuries. There are two types of damages: general and special.

Damages

When a person is injured or their property damaged, they usually make a claim to recover damages. This is a type of tort law where the person (the plaintiff) claims monetary compensation for the harm that they've suffered as the result of another person's wrongful actions or negligence.

Personal injury litigation can result in a variety of damages, including punitive and compensatory damages. Both types of damages award money based on the level of damage caused by a defendant's negligent or intentional act.

Compensatory damages (or "economic damages") are granted to the plaintiff to cover their expenses and losses caused by the incident. This type of damages are usually awarded to the victims of car accidents , trucking crashes, slip and falls, or other incidents that cause financial loss or physical injuries.

These awards are designed to help the victim financially whole again following an incident. They could include medical bills, lost wages, and rehabilitation costs. They also aim to provide compensation for suffering and pain emotional anguish, mental trauma, and loss of enjoyment of life.

The amount of compensation is usually more expensive for serious injuries such as brain trauma or broken legs. These injuries are generally more costly and require a longer time to recover.

The amount of compensation for economic losses is contingent on how serious the incident was and is difficult to calculate. It is vital to keep detailed documents of your losses as well as expenses.

This will enable your lawyer to determine the real value and the extent of your claim. A detailed history of your medical expenses as well as other losses can increase your chances of getting a full reimbursement from your insurance company.

Non-economic damages, or "pain and suffering," are more challenging to quantify. This is because pain and suffering often involves both physical and emotional pain. These injuries can be anything from embarrassment to depression or PTSD (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der).

A lawyer will help you determine the right amount of your non-economic losses and create a compelling case to get it. They will go through your doctor's records and interview witnesses to record the extent of your pain, suffering and loss. During trial, they'll present the evidence to jurors.

Limitations law

Each state has its own laws that establish specific deadlines for filing different types of claims. In the case of personal injury litigation, these statutes generally allow for a two-year time period for bringing an action against someone who has inflicting harm on you or your loved family members.

The time limits are intended to stop lawsuits from going on indefinitely, and also to make it easier for potential claimants to not delay in making their claims. The reason is that as time passes, evidence can be lost or stale , and a claim becomes difficult to prove in court.

While the statute of limitation isn't always easy to understand It is crucial to be aware that the clock starts ticking when you are harmed or that your claim was first discovered. This is known as the "discovery rule."

As you can see the deadline for filing a personal injury claim can differ from one state another. The time frame for your particular case will depend on many factors, including the type and location of the claim.

In Pennsylvania the standard time frame for personal injury claims is generally two years from the date of your injury. There are exceptions to this rule which can lengthen or reduce the deadline.

The discovery rule is among the most popular exceptions. The rule of discovery states that you have to file a claim within specified time after you have been competent to conclude that your injury was caused by negligence of another party.

If you're unsure of when the time limit will begin running in your case, it's crucial to consult with an experienced lawyer who can advise you on your rights and assist you in obtaining the compensation you are entitled to after being hurt by another person's negligent or reckless actions.

Furthermore, the statute of limitations can be tolled (put on hold) in a variety of circumstances. This is the case when a plaintiff is a minor and a defendant was not in the state when the accident took place. The tolling or suspension of the statute of limitations may aid in protecting your legal rights and ensure you receive the justice you deserve when you are injured by the negligence of someone else.

Trial

The majority of personal injury cases settle themselves through settlements, which are typically the result of negotiation between the parties. However certain cases are resolved in court and a process which involves arguing before a judge or jury who decides if the defendant was accountable for the plaintiff's injuries and also the amount of compensation they should receive.

We have to file a formal complaint outlining the incident and naming the person who you want to seek compensation. The complaint is then served to the defendant and they are required to respond to your complaint.

Then, your lawyer will then enter into the fact-finding portion of the case, which is known as discovery. This allows both sides to exchange evidence including witness testimony, documents, photographs and video footage of the scene. This includes depositions, interview, and physical examinations.

After all of this preparation is finished After all of this preparation is completed, it's time for the actual trial. This is when the lawyers for both sides argue their case and present evidence to a judge or jury.

Then, both sides will be asked to make an opening statement , in which they explain the details of their case. Depending on the size of the case and the number of witnesses, this could take between 30 and 45 minutes per side.

Next the two sides will make their closing arguments before the jury. These may last for up to a couple of minutes and will then discuss their claims and damages. The judge will then give instructions to the jury that will provide the legal requirements they be required to follow to make a decision.

The jury will then consider on your case before making a decision. The verdict will then be presented to the judge for review. If the jury decides in favor of you, they will award you the verdict. If they rule in favor of the defendant they won't give you an award and your case is dismissed.

In on-line baccarat, the game is played between two hands: the Player and the Banker. Each hand is dealt two cards, and extra playing cards could additionally be drawn according to specific rules. Numbered cards carry their face values, while face playing cards and tens are valued at zero. The hand value is set by adding the cardboard values and taking the final digit of the total. If either the Player or Banker has a total of eight or nine, it is known as a 'natural,' and no additional playing cards are drawn.

Baccarat is a casino card sport during which gamers purpose to realize a hand with a value closest to nine. With its roots tracing again to European the Aristocracy, baccarat has developed into a well-liked on-line recreation enjoyed by lovers worldwide. Casinos provide varied versions, like Punto Banco, Chemin de Fer, and Baccarat Banque, each with barely different rules and gameplay variations.
